Founded in 2007, The Real Ideas Organisation CIC uses social enterprise to create new opportunities for young people and adults, making real change happen.

Business Units

We run five individual business units which each offer specific products and services, from hand crafted skate ramps to schools consultancy:

RIO Schools Service
Social Enterprise Qualification
Devonport Guildhall
XtraVert
Devonport Plus

Based in the Southwest but operating nationally and internationally, our business units work with a wide range of customers; from headteachers, schools and youth groups to local authorities, private businesses and individuals.

Awards RIO has Won Previous / Next
  • Building Schools For The Future National Awards

    Partnership for Schools’ Innovation in Student Engagement Award at Excellence in BSF National Awards, November 2009.

  • IWREL, Quality Standards Framework Award

    IWREL, Quality Standards Framework Award recognising commitment to supporting Work Related Learning and Enterprise in schools, June 2010.

  • European Social Fund (ESF) Awards

    Best South West Employment and Skills Programme at South West European Social Fund (ESF) Awards, March 2010.

  • Plymouth City Council and The Herald's Business and Abercrombie Award

    Best Social Enterprise at Business and Abercrombie Awards, April 2011
